What You Need to Know About Rhinoplasty

Recovery and Cost

Now that you've seen some nose job before and after photos, let's talk about what you need to know before going through with the procedure. First of all, recovery time can vary depending on the extent of the surgery. Generally, you can expect to take about a week off from work or school to recover. In terms of cost, you're looking at around $5,000 to $10,000 for a nose job. However, keep in mind that this cost can vary depending on where you live, your surgeon's expertise, and the complexity of the procedure.

Choosing the Right Surgeon

Do Your Research

Before you commit to a surgeon for your nose job, it's important to do your research. Look at before and after photos of their previous patients, read reviews online, and make sure they're board-certified. You want to make sure you're entrusting your appearance to someone who knows what they're doing.

The Day of Your Surgery

What to Expect

On the day of your nose job, you'll likely be given anesthesia so that you won't feel any pain or discomfort. The surgery itself typically takes a few hours, and you'll be monitored closely by medical professionals throughout the procedure. Once it's over, you'll need someone to drive you home, as you'll still be under the effects of the anesthesia.

The Results

Are They Permanent?

The results of your nose job will be permanent, but keep in mind that your nose will continue to age with the rest of your body. Additionally, if you have a traumatic injury to your nose in the future, it could affect the results of your procedure. Follow your surgeon's instructions for caring for your nose to ensure that you get the most out of your procedure.
